TPL Energy versus Solarsol

Compare Solar Panel Manufacturers: TPL Energy vs Solarsol

EnergyPal TPL Energy Solar Panels Manufacturer

Website:

http://www.tplsolar.com

Country:

China

Address:

Weier Road, Economic Zone, Taizhou, Jiangsu

EnergyPal Solarsol Solar Panels Manufacturer

Website:

https://www.solarsol.mx

Country:

Mexico

Address:

Calle 73 No.218E Int.1x Av. Ind. No Contaminants Col. Poligono Chuburna 97302, Merida, Yucatan

Compare TPL Energy TPL285P-60 with Solarsol Solar Panels